我想知道我的应用程序中是否有 USB 线连接到我的 iPhone。我进行了很多研究,我找到了一种使用充电电平/充电检测的电缆连接的解决方案。但这对我没有帮助。
如何使用 EAAccessory 检测 USB?
谢谢, 阿南德
我想知道我的应用程序中是否有 USB 线连接到我的 iPhone。我进行了很多研究,我找到了一种使用充电电平/充电检测的电缆连接的解决方案。但这对我没有帮助。
如何使用 EAAccessory 检测 USB?
谢谢, 阿南德
使用 EAAccessoryManager 尝试此代码。它会在配件连接或断开连接时发出通知。
[[EAAccessoryManager sharedAccessoryManager] registerForLocalNotifications];
NSNotificationCenter *notificationCenter = [NSNotificationCenter defaultCenter];
[notificationCenter addObserver:self
selector:@selector(accessoryDidConnect:)
name:EAAccessoryDidConnectNotification
object:nil];
[notificationCenter addObserver:self
selector:@selector(accessoryDidDisconnect:)
name:EAAccessoryDidDisconnectNotification
object:nil];